It’s only recently that the founder Stan Berman has hung up the apron, but you can still get some of that original recipe from the Stan’s in Chicago by ordering online. While the city's donut scene is as wide, varied, and as vanguard as it gets, the company's founder knows how to do it right.Įventually, Stan's Donuts and Coffee expanded the menu and franchised over 20 locations in Chicago. Stan’s Donuts and Coffee began in Los Angeles, where the donut finally found its true frosting.
